We are looking for a Customer Service Representative to join our team and support an automotive technology product used in the United States.

Our client develops an automotive diagnostic device connected to a mobile app, allowing users to access real-time vehicle information, report issues, and receive support directly from their smartphones. As a CSR, you will play a key role in this experience by helping users understand what’s happening with their vehicle and guiding them through the next steps.

This is NOT a sales role. It is a customer support position, focused on handling calls, creating tickets, providing follow-ups, and resolving issues.

100% on-site position at WeWork – Av. Las Américas, Country Club.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the first point of contact for U.S.-based users via phone, email, and chat
  • Assist customers when there is an issue with their vehicle or diagnostic device
  • Resolve issues during the call when possible; otherwise, create and manage tickets for other teams
  • Clearly explain next steps and follow up with users until resolution
  • Document interactions and feedback in the CRM system
  • Collaborate with technical and support teams to resolve complex cases
  • Provide product guidance and onboarding support when needed
  • Share customer insights to help improve the product and support processes
